I just bought the 1999 Mercedes-Benz C-Class S202.II C250 Turbo Diesel Estate Auto with no gearbox. I would like to buy a replacement gearbox(automatic gearbox) and the dealers are all asking me about the part number(supposedly to be on the side of the gearbox). Can some please advise on the part number as I am unable to obtain the part number from teh previous owner. The engine's VIN is WDB2021882f882076 if that will assist in any way
 
The various Merc breakers would all know exactly what you need, I think.
i.e. a 722.6 (pre-tiptronic) 5 speed which the C250 had from 96 to 99/00. I don't think there was any variation across the models, just the one auto box.
